#260cfb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#260cfb is composed of 14.9% red, 4.7% green and 98.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.9% cyan, 95.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 1.6% black. It has a hue angle of 246.5 degrees, a saturation of 96.8% and a lightness of 51.6%. #260cfb color hex could be obtained by blending #4c18ff with #0000f7. Closest websafe color is: #3300ff.

#260cfb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#260cfb has RGB values of R:38, G:12, B:251 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 2493691.

Shades and Tints of #260cfb
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010008 is the darkest color, while #f5f4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#260cfb
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7f7e89 is the less saturated color, while #260cfb is the most saturated one.
